Runway Pros
- Best-in-class AI video generation
- Comprehensive editing suite beyond just AI
- Used by professional filmmakers
- Regular model improvements
- Multiple creative tools in one platform
- Good free tier for testing
Runway Cons
- Credits consumed quickly on video gen
- Generated videos still limited to ~10 seconds
- Expensive for heavy video production use
- Quality varies significantly by prompt
- Rendering can be slow during peak times
- Limited fine-tuning options
Microsoft Copilot Pros
- Seamless Microsoft 365 integration
- Strong for enterprise workflows
- Web browsing and citations
- DALL-E image generation included
- Meeting summaries in Teams
- Enterprise security and compliance
Microsoft Copilot Cons
- Requires Microsoft 365 subscription for full value
- Expensive at $30/user for enterprise tier
- Slower than dedicated AI tools
- Quality inconsistent across Office apps
- Less capable for coding than Copilot for GitHub
- Locked into Microsoft ecosystem
